Courses and Research Interests
Courses: General Zoology (Biology 120), General Biology II (Biology 102) and Biostatistics (Biology 293)
Research Interstes: Conservation and ecology of reptiles and amphibians in southern New England and the Mid-Atlantic

Papers, Notes and Other Works 

Tupper TA, Bozarth CA, Galitzin T, Dawson K. (In progress) Detection of Batrachochytrium dendrobatidis in the eastern spadefoot toad (Scaphiopus h. hollbrookii) at Cape Cod National Seashore, USA. Herpetological Review 0:00

Curtain K, Tupper TA, Aguilar R (In progress): Microhabitat variables influencing site occupancy of the eastern worm snake, Carphophis a. amoenus, at the Smithsonian Environmental Research Center, Maryland USA. Herpetological Bulletin: 0:00.

Tupper TA, Galitzin T, Bozarth CA, Lawlor DM. (In review): Calling anuran surveys at Huntley Meadows Park Fairfax County, Virginia. Banesteria 0:00.

Tupper TA, Streicher J,  Greenspan S, Timm BC, Cook RP. (2011):  Detection of Batrachochytrium dendrobatidis in anurans of Cape Cod National Seashore, USA. Herpetological Review 42: 61-65 (uncorrected proof attached).

Cook RP,  Tupper TA, Paton PWC, Timm BC.  (2011): Effects of temperature and temporal factors on anuran detection probabilities at Cape Cod National Seashore:
Implications for long-term monitoring. Herpetological Conservation and Biology 6:25-39

Tupper TA, McLean MD,  Buchanan S. (2009): Oviposition in  northern clade B. fowleri: implications for conservation. Applied Herpetology 6: 343-353.

Tupper TA, Adams LB, Timm BC.  (2009): Bufo fowleri diet.  Herpetological Review 40: 200-201.

Tupper TA, Cook RP.  (2008): Habitat variables influencing breeding effort in northern clade Bufo fowleri: implications for conservation. Applied Herpetology 5:101-119.

Tupper TA, Cook RP, Timm BC, Goodstine A. (2007): Improving call surveys for detecting the Fowler’s toad, Bufo fowleri, in Southern New England, USA. Applied Herpetology. 4: 245-259. 

Paton PWC, Timm BC, Tupper TA. (2003): Monitoring pond breeding amphibians. Long-term coastal monitoring protocol at Cape Cod National Seashore, p. 113. National Park Service. Wellfleet, Massachusetts.
